Gambling and information theory - Wikipedia Statistical inference might be thought of as gambling theory applied to the world around us. The myriad applications for logarithmic information measures tell us precisely how to take the best guess in the face of partial information. In that sense, information theory might be considered a formal expression of the theory of gambling. It is no ... The Theory of Gambling and Statistical Logic by Richard A ...
